Ingredients

Main Ingredients for Hearty Creamy Basil Chicken

– 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ts

– 1 cup heavy cream

– 1 cup fresh basil leaves, finely chopped

Additional Ingredients

– 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il

– 3 cloves garlic, minced

– 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ved

Seasonings

– 1 teaspoon fine sea salt

– 1/2 teaspoon freshly cracked black pepper

– 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ning blend

– Grated Parmesan cheese, for garnish

Step-by-Step Instructions

Preparing the Chicken

First, season the chicken breasts. Use fine sea salt, black pepper, and Italian seasoning. This mix makes the chicken so tasty. Make sure to coat both sides evenly. For even seasoning, sprinkle the spices from a height. This will help spread them well.

Cooking the Chicken

Next,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Wait until the oil shimmers. Then, add the seasoned chicken. Cook for about 6-7 minutes per side. Look for a nice golden brown color. The chicken needs to reach 165°F (75°C) inside. Use a meat thermometer to check. Once done, remove the chicken and keep it warm on a plate.

Creating the Creamy Sauce

Now it’s time for the sauce. Keep the skillet on the heat and add minced garlic. Sauté it for a minute, stirring often. You want it fragrant but not brown. Slowly pour in the heavy cream. Stir while scraping up the tasty bits stuck to the skillet. These bits add great flavor to your sauce.

Finalizing the Dish

Add halved cherry tomatoes and chopped basil to the sauce. Let it simmer for 3-4 minutes. This will soften the tomatoes and thicken the sauce. Finally, return the chicken to the skillet. FAQs

How do I know when the chicken is done cooking?

You can tell chicken is done when it’s golden brown and the juices run clear. The best way is to use a meat thermometer. Insert it into the thickest part of the chicken.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(75°C). If you don’t have a thermometer, cut into the chicken. It should not be pink inside. Properly cooked chicken is juicy and tender.

Can I use dried basil instead of fresh?

Yes, you can use dried basil. However, fresh basil has a brighter flavor. If you use dried basil, remember it is stronger. Use about one-third of the amount. So, if the recipe calls for one cup of fresh basil, use about one-third cup of dried. Add it earlier in the cooking process to let the flavors blend.

Can I make this recipe 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are this dish ahead of time. Cook the chicken and sauce, then store them separately in the fridge. This keeps the chicken from getting soggy. You can store them for up to three days. When ready to eat, simply reheat the chicken and sauce together in a skillet.

How can I adjust the creaminess of the sauce?

To make the sauce creamier, add more heavy cream. You can also use cream cheese for a thicker texture. If you want less creaminess, reduce the amount of cream. You can add chicken broth to thin the sauce while keeping the flavor.
